Abstract :
Korea has developed a helium cooled ceramic reflector (HCCR) test blanket module (TBM) consisting of four sub-modules in an ITER. From the draft design of the side wall (SW) according to a thermal-hydraulic analysis, a mechanical analysis was performed considering a design channel pressure of 10 MPa. The SW comprised of sixteen grids with the seventeen partitions for the manifold function satisfied 1.5Sm of the allowable stress (Sm) according to RCC-MR code at the maximum stress region in the SW. In addition, an elastic analysis of the draft design of the back manifold (BM) was carried out, which supported the four sub-modules in the HCCR TBM and has the main inlet/outlet of the He cooling pipe, the measurement pipes, and He purge gas lines from the port cell. The results show that the maximum stress was higher than 1.5Sm, and the BM design has been modified to satisfy the BM function and requirements.
